BOSS 8.0.0
BESIII Offline Software System
Loading...
Searching...
No Matches
ITofSimSvc Class Referenceabstract

#include <ITofSimSvc.h>

Inheritance diagram for ITofSimSvc:

Public Member Functions

 DeclareInterfaceID (ITofSimSvc, 1, 0)
virtual const double BarLowThres ()=0
virtual const double BarHighThres ()=0
virtual const double EndLowThres ()=0
virtual const double EndHighThres ()=0
virtual const double BarPMTGain ()=0
virtual const double EndPMTGain ()=0
virtual const double BarConstant ()=0
virtual const double EndConstant ()=0
virtual const double EndNoiseSwitch ()=0
virtual const double BarGain1 (unsigned int id)=0
virtual const double BarGain2 (unsigned int id)=0
virtual const double EndGain (unsigned int id)=0
virtual const double BarAttenLength (unsigned int id)=0
virtual const double EndAttenLength (unsigned int id)=0
virtual const double EndNoiseSmear (unsigned int id)=0
virtual void Dump ()=0
 DeclareInterfaceID (ITofSimSvc, 1, 0)
virtual const double BarLowThres ()=0
virtual const double BarHighThres ()=0
virtual const double EndLowThres ()=0
virtual const double EndHighThres ()=0
virtual const double BarPMTGain ()=0
virtual const double EndPMTGain ()=0
virtual const double BarConstant ()=0
virtual const double EndConstant ()=0
virtual const double EndNoiseSwitch ()=0
virtual const double BarGain1 (unsigned int id)=0
virtual const double BarGain2 (unsigned int id)=0
virtual const double EndGain (unsigned int id)=0
virtual const double BarAttenLength (unsigned int id)=0
virtual const double EndAttenLength (unsigned int id)=0
virtual const double EndNoiseSmear (unsigned int id)=0
virtual void Dump ()=0
 DeclareInterfaceID (ITofSimSvc, 1, 0)
virtual const double BarLowThres ()=0
virtual const double BarHighThres ()=0
virtual const double EndLowThres ()=0
virtual const double EndHighThres ()=0
virtual const double BarPMTGain ()=0
virtual const double EndPMTGain ()=0
virtual const double BarConstant ()=0
virtual const double EndConstant ()=0
virtual const double EndNoiseSwitch ()=0
virtual const double BarGain1 (unsigned int id)=0
virtual const double BarGain2 (unsigned int id)=0
virtual const double EndGain (unsigned int id)=0
virtual const double BarAttenLength (unsigned int id)=0
virtual const double EndAttenLength (unsigned int id)=0
virtual const double EndNoiseSmear (unsigned int id)=0
virtual void Dump ()=0

Detailed Description

Member Function Documentation

◆ BarAttenLength() [1/3]

virtual const double ITofSimSvc::BarAttenLength ( unsigned int id)
pure virtual

◆ BarAttenLength() [2/3]

virtual const double ITofSimSvc::BarAttenLength ( unsigned int id)
pure virtual

◆ BarAttenLength() [3/3]

virtual const double ITofSimSvc::BarAttenLength ( unsigned int id)
pure virtual

◆ BarConstant() [1/3]

virtual const double ITofSimSvc::BarConstant ( )
pure virtual

◆ BarConstant() [2/3]

virtual const double ITofSimSvc::BarConstant ( )
pure virtual

◆ BarConstant() [3/3]

virtual const double ITofSimSvc::BarConstant ( )
pure virtual

◆ BarGain1() [1/3]

virtual const double ITofSimSvc::BarGain1 ( unsigned int id)
pure virtual

◆ BarGain1() [2/3]

virtual const double ITofSimSvc::BarGain1 ( unsigned int id)
pure virtual

◆ BarGain1() [3/3]

virtual const double ITofSimSvc::BarGain1 ( unsigned int id)
pure virtual

◆ BarGain2() [1/3]

virtual const double ITofSimSvc::BarGain2 ( unsigned int id)
pure virtual

◆ BarGain2() [2/3]

virtual const double ITofSimSvc::BarGain2 ( unsigned int id)
pure virtual

◆ BarGain2() [3/3]

virtual const double ITofSimSvc::BarGain2 ( unsigned int id)
pure virtual

◆ BarHighThres() [1/3]

virtual const double ITofSimSvc::BarHighThres ( )
pure virtual

◆ BarHighThres() [2/3]

virtual const double ITofSimSvc::BarHighThres ( )
pure virtual

◆ BarHighThres() [3/3]

virtual const double ITofSimSvc::BarHighThres ( )
pure virtual

◆ BarLowThres() [1/3]

virtual const double ITofSimSvc::BarLowThres ( )
pure virtual

◆ BarLowThres() [2/3]

virtual const double ITofSimSvc::BarLowThres ( )
pure virtual

◆ BarLowThres() [3/3]

virtual const double ITofSimSvc::BarLowThres ( )
pure virtual

◆ BarPMTGain() [1/3]

virtual const double ITofSimSvc::BarPMTGain ( )
pure virtual

◆ BarPMTGain() [2/3]

virtual const double ITofSimSvc::BarPMTGain ( )
pure virtual

◆ BarPMTGain() [3/3]

virtual const double ITofSimSvc::BarPMTGain ( )
pure virtual

◆ DeclareInterfaceID() [1/3]

ITofSimSvc::DeclareInterfaceID ( ITofSimSvc ,
1 ,
0  )

◆ DeclareInterfaceID() [2/3]

ITofSimSvc::DeclareInterfaceID ( ITofSimSvc ,
1 ,
0  )

◆ DeclareInterfaceID() [3/3]

ITofSimSvc::DeclareInterfaceID ( ITofSimSvc ,
1 ,
0  )

◆ Dump() [1/3]

virtual void ITofSimSvc::Dump ( )
pure virtual

◆ Dump() [2/3]

virtual void ITofSimSvc::Dump ( )
pure virtual

◆ Dump() [3/3]

virtual void ITofSimSvc::Dump ( )
pure virtual

◆ EndAttenLength() [1/3]

virtual const double ITofSimSvc::EndAttenLength ( unsigned int id)
pure virtual

◆ EndAttenLength() [2/3]

virtual const double ITofSimSvc::EndAttenLength ( unsigned int id)
pure virtual

◆ EndAttenLength() [3/3]

virtual const double ITofSimSvc::EndAttenLength ( unsigned int id)
pure virtual

◆ EndConstant() [1/3]

virtual const double ITofSimSvc::EndConstant ( )
pure virtual

◆ EndConstant() [2/3]

virtual const double ITofSimSvc::EndConstant ( )
pure virtual

◆ EndConstant() [3/3]

virtual const double ITofSimSvc::EndConstant ( )
pure virtual

◆ EndGain() [1/3]

virtual const double ITofSimSvc::EndGain ( unsigned int id)
pure virtual

◆ EndGain() [2/3]

virtual const double ITofSimSvc::EndGain ( unsigned int id)
pure virtual

◆ EndGain() [3/3]

virtual const double ITofSimSvc::EndGain ( unsigned int id)
pure virtual

◆ EndHighThres() [1/3]

virtual const double ITofSimSvc::EndHighThres ( )
pure virtual

◆ EndHighThres() [2/3]

virtual const double ITofSimSvc::EndHighThres ( )
pure virtual

◆ EndHighThres() [3/3]

virtual const double ITofSimSvc::EndHighThres ( )
pure virtual

◆ EndLowThres() [1/3]

virtual const double ITofSimSvc::EndLowThres ( )
pure virtual

◆ EndLowThres() [2/3]

virtual const double ITofSimSvc::EndLowThres ( )
pure virtual

◆ EndLowThres() [3/3]

virtual const double ITofSimSvc::EndLowThres ( )
pure virtual

◆ EndNoiseSmear() [1/3]

virtual const double ITofSimSvc::EndNoiseSmear ( unsigned int id)
pure virtual

◆ EndNoiseSmear() [2/3]

virtual const double ITofSimSvc::EndNoiseSmear ( unsigned int id)
pure virtual

◆ EndNoiseSmear() [3/3]

virtual const double ITofSimSvc::EndNoiseSmear ( unsigned int id)
pure virtual

◆ EndNoiseSwitch() [1/3]

virtual const double ITofSimSvc::EndNoiseSwitch ( )
pure virtual

◆ EndNoiseSwitch() [2/3]

virtual const double ITofSimSvc::EndNoiseSwitch ( )
pure virtual

◆ EndNoiseSwitch() [3/3]

virtual const double ITofSimSvc::EndNoiseSwitch ( )
pure virtual

◆ EndPMTGain() [1/3]

virtual const double ITofSimSvc::EndPMTGain ( )
pure virtual

◆ EndPMTGain() [2/3]

virtual const double ITofSimSvc::EndPMTGain ( )
pure virtual

◆ EndPMTGain() [3/3]

virtual const double ITofSimSvc::EndPMTGain ( )
pure virtual

The documentation for this class was generated from the following files: